Karen Carpenter is considered one of the best vocalists of all time and her legacy lives on, more than 40 years after her death.

The musician was the lead singer and drummer of the highly successful duo the Carpenters, which she formed with her older brother Richard.

The music world was left shocked when Karen, who was praised for her vocal skills, and had a distinctive three-octave contralto range, passed away at the age of only 32 on February 4, 1983.

Based on her autopsy report, Karen’s immediate cause of death was established as Hyperosmolar coma – now called Hyperglycemic Hyperosmolar State (HHS).

The condition, which can be fatal if not treated immediately, is characterized by extremely high blood sugar, severe dehydration and high blood osmolality (concentrated blood), Cleveland Clinic explains.

The autopsy, released on March 11, 1973, attributed Karen’s death to “emetine cardiotoxicity due to or as a consequence of anorexia nervosa.”

Her blood sugar was found to be 1,110 milligrams per deciliter (61.6 mmol/L), more than 10 times the average. The autopsy revealed that Karen was found unresponsive on her kitchen floor by her mother, who immediately called the emergency services.

Paramedics initiated CPR while transporting the singer to Downey Community Hospital in California, but life saving efforts were “of no avail” and she she was pronounced dead.

It said, “Close examination revealed no indications of trauma or foul play.”

Chief Medical Examiner-Coroner, who performed the autopsy, wrote, “From the anatomic findings and pertinent history I ascribed death to: (A) EMETINE CARDIOTOXICITY DUE TO AS AS A CONSEQUENCE OF (B) ANOREXIA NERVOSA.”

In the biography Lead Sister: The Story of Karen Carpenter, which was released in 2023, author Lucy O’Brien revealed that, a year before her death, the singer spent six months in intensive, $100-a-session therapy in a bid to improve her health.

During the sessions, Karen admitted to taking more than 90 laxatives a day in order to expel food from her body – which led her to dropping to just 89lbs (40kg/6.3stone).

Lucy said, “Karen’s willingness to set aside the time and the money showed her initial level of commitment to the therapy.”

In an excerpt from the biography, published by The Hollywood Reporter, the writer stated Karen’s “compulsive behaviors” that had developed would need to be dislodged.

This started with cutting down the amount of laxatives, as well as her use of thyroid medication Synthroid, which speeds up metabolism to lose weight faster.

Overuse of Synthroid could lead to dangerous consequences, with an overdose highly increasing the odds of her falling into a coma or having a heart attack.

When Karen rebelled against the help from Dr Steven Levenkron, he allegedly responded, “But you do need care because you are incompetent…because you can’t keep yourself alive.”

Ultimately, in September 1982, Karen would be admitted into Lennox Hill Hospital in New York, and placed on an IV nutrient drip in a bid to keep her alive.

While it worked, the weight increase put a strain on her heart. Nonetheless, returning to California that November, Karen had started looking forward to a healthier future, even planning a tour with her brother and writing music again.

But sadly, her life was cut short when she passed away in February the following year.
